Senior Executive Assistant | 6-month contract | Immediate Start | London (Hybrid) | £200–£225 per day (Umbrella)
My client, a global organisation within the insurance sector, is looking for an experienced Senior Executive Assistant to provide dedicated 1:1 support to a C-suite executive within Global Operations. This is a fast-paced, highly visible role requiring exceptional organisational skills, experience supporting senior stakeholders across multiple time zones, and the ability to operate confidently within a complex global environment. Previous insurance sector experience is highly desirable.
Responsibilities
Provide dedicated 1:1 support to a C-suite executive, managing a complex and ever-changing diary across multiple time zones
Coordinate international and domestic travel, including itineraries, visas, accommodation, and logistics
Organise leadership meetings, offsites, business reviews, and executive events
Prepare presentations, briefing packs, reports, meeting agendas, and other executive documentation
Manage executive inboxes, correspondence, expenses, and action tracking
Build strong relationships with senior stakeholders, Executive Assistants, and external contacts across global offices
Take meeting minutes, monitor actions, and ensure deadlines are met
Support onboarding activities for new team members, including equipment and system access
Skills
Significant Executive Assistant experience supporting C-suite or senior executives within a global organisation
Previous experience within the insurance sector is highly desirable
Strong experience managing complex international diaries and travel arrangements
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ills
Advanced Microsoft Office skills, including Outlook, Excel, PowerPoint, and Teams
Highly organised with exceptional att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ple priorities
Professional, discreet, and confident handling confidential information
Package
£200–£225 per day (Umbrella)
Hybrid working – London office with flexibility to work from home
Immediate start preferred
Opportunity to join a well-established global organisation in a high-profile executive support role
